Architectural Innovation and Engineering Breakthroughs
What makes megastructures truly fascinating is how they push the boundaries of what architects and engineers believe is possible. We’re talking about structures that seemed impossible just decades ago—and yet here they are, standing tall and functional. The architectural possibilities continue expanding thanks to advances in materials science, computer modeling, and construction technology. It’s genuinely exciting stuff that redefines what’s architecturally possible today.
- Advanced Materials: Carbon fiber composites, self-healing concrete, and adaptive materials allow structures to be lighter, stronger, and more sustainable.
- Computational Design: AI and machine learning optimize designs, reducing waste and maximizing structural efficiency.
- Modular Construction: Building megastructures using prefabricated modules speeds up construction and improves quality control.
- Earthquake and Climate Resilience: Modern megastructures incorporate technology to withstand extreme weather, seismic activity, and climate change impacts.
- 3D Printing at Scale: Emerging 3D construction printing technology enables faster, more precise building of massive structures.
Sustainability and Environmental Considerations
Here’s something that might surprise you—megastructures can actually be more sustainable than sprawling developments. When you concentrate density and integrate green systems, massive projects can reduce per-capita environmental impact significantly. Transforming cities through megastructures gives planners the opportunity to build sustainability into every aspect from the ground up. It’s about being smarter, not just bigger.
- Energy Efficiency at Scale: Large structures benefit from economies of scale in heating, cooling, and power distribution systems.
- Reduced Urban Sprawl: Vertical megastructures prevent cities from expanding endlessly, preserving natural habitats and green spaces.
- Integrated Waste Management: Modern megastructures feature sophisticated recycling and waste processing systems built into their infrastructure.
- Water Conservation Systems: Massive buildings implement rainwater harvesting, greywater recycling, and advanced treatment facilities.
